Transaction 93aea483766fc81083ce382d532dd558f93089c1462f51571853e5e31f820f9b
2 Input
2 Outputs
- 93aea483766fc81083ce382d532dd558f93089c1462f51571853e5e31f820f9b:0
- 93aea483766fc81083ce382d532dd558f93089c1462f51571853e5e31f820f9b:1
value 11298779
address 17MCKBhLpzKbCNod3N5cnN5CpsZb3MqsqZ
value 160809
address 1QGASr5ubhu61RgoWDaJU6seLZR8QnUPX8